Collin College film series screens ‘The Wicker Man’

by | Feb 8, 2016 | Education

Collin College’s Auteur Film Series will screen “The Wicker Man” at 7 p.m. on Tuesday, Feb. 9 at the Spring Creek Campus Living Legends Conference Center as part of its 2015-2016 “Religion: Opiate or Oracle” theme. Spring Creek Campus is located at 2800 E. Spring Creek Parkway in Plano.

Starring Edward Woodward and Christopher Lee, this thriller revolves around the search for a missing girl in a Scottish island village and the unusual religious rites a detective finds as he investigates.

The screening is free and open to the public. Doors open 30 minutes before the film begins, and seating is limited. Some material may not be suitable for all audiences. After the screening, there will be a panel discussion led by Collin College faculty and staff.

For more information, including film ratings, visit www.collin.edu/academics/csce/auteurfilmseries.html or contact Dr. Carolyn Perry at [email protected]. The Auteur Film Series is supported by the Communication and Humanities Division at Collin College.
